Great Lakes Brewery Releases Collaboration with Charlie Papazian for Ontario Craft Brewers Conference

TORONTO, ON – Great Lakes Brewery has announced the release of a new collaboration with Charlie Papazian, an icon and pioneer in the worlds of homebrewing and craft brewing.

Fist Bump Hybrid Lager (5% abv), described as “an American style hybrid lager [with] intoxicating floral complexity and clean smooth earthy hop bitterness”, has the following backstory:

A work in progress for close to a year, Charlie was to be in Niagara Falls this week as a guest of honour and keynote speaker for the Ontario Craft Brewers Conference. There were also plans for Charlie to visit us here at GLB to work on a beer together. Unfortunately, COVID changed those plans…

However, the show must go on, so, from the comforts of his home in Colorado, Charlie will virtually kick things off the conference on October 27th, and a beer was still brewed.

Over a delicious Zoom call back in September, GLB and Charlie teamed up to collaborate on Fist Bump, an American style hybrid lager. Charlie spent time with Mike Lackey (Brewing Operations Manager) and Nick Perry (Brewer, 7 Barrel Series) going over the recipe that he generously provided, chatted ingredients and crucial steps in the brewing process, shared some stories and answered a bunch of our questions.

Fist Bump is available now at the Great Lakes retail store and online shop. For more details, see the full release announcement.
